What it is
What AAMedP-1.9 covers
AAMedP-1.9 is NATO's Allied Aeromedical Publication for the initial investigation and immediate management of a suspected laser eye injury in aircrew. Edition C, Version 1 was promulgated in September 2025 and supersedes Edition B, Version 1. Its purpose is consistency: a military medical officer anywhere in NATO takes the same history, runs a comparable initial examination, and reaches a decision on returning an aircrew member to flying duties on a consistent basis, whatever nation they serve.
This is a document for the flight surgeon, the examining medical officer and the ophthalmologists and optometrists a case is referred to, not for a general equipment manufacturer or software supplier. Nothing in it names a contract clause, a certification scheme, or any other route by which a company is bound. Chapter 1 sets out why the publication exists: lasers are increasingly used by the military, including in force exercises, and are capable of producing serious eye injury even at distance, so aircrew and other personnel need a shared understanding of the risk. It goes on to describe, in general terms, how a laser can affect vision: a lingering but temporary glare or after-image with no lasting damage, as distinct from actual injury to the cornea, lens or retina. The clinical pathway: named, not reproduced
Chapter 2 sets out the pathway a suspected laser incident follows: a baseline examination of aircrew on entry to and exit from a laser-risk environment, a structured post-incident history taken using the questions at Annex A, a post-incident clinical examination, treatment, and a return-to-duty assessment, alongside guidance on the psychological impact of an incident and on educating aircrew before one occurs. Each stage is addressed to the examining medical officer. This page names that they exist, because they shape what a nation's aeromedical service needs to have in place, but it does not reproduce the examination technique, the treatment, or the criteria used to judge fitness to fly: those are a qualified clinician's professional judgement, not a compliance criterion a reader applies themselves.
The document is precise even about vocabulary: it asks an examiner taking a post-incident history to avoid one commonly used word for what an aircrew member saw, because its meaning varies too much between people, and to use a more specific word instead, so that reports of an incident compare properly across nations.
Annex A is a structured set of questions covering the circumstances of a suspected exposure and its possible effects, for the examiner to work through with the aircrew member. Annex B reproduces the test chart Chapter 2 refers to. Neither is reproduced here.
How it binds
AAMedP-1.9 sits under STANAG 7165, the NATO agreement recording nations' commitment to use it, approved by the nations in the Military Committee Air Standardization Board. That is the cover which gives the publication its force: a national armed force applies AAMedP-1.9 once that nation has adopted the STANAG, not by virtue of the document existing. Two nations recorded reservations against it at the time of promulgation, over aspects of the specialist care Chapter 2 describes; this page does not detail them, because they are a national capacity question rather than anything an external organisation supplies.

Questions
Is AAMedP-1.9 mandatory?
It binds NATO nations through STANAG 7165, the agreement recording their commitment to use it, and nations recorded reservations against specific aspects of it at the time of promulgation. It reaches a national armed force through that agreement, not through a customer contract or a market regulation.
Does AAMedP-1.9 set clinical examination or treatment criteria?
It names that an initial examination, a post-incident history and examination, treatment and a return-to-duty assessment all take place, in Chapter 2, but it leaves the clinical judgement itself to a qualified flight surgeon or medical officer. This page does not reproduce examination technique, treatment or fitness-to-fly criteria.
Can an organisation be "AAMedP-1.9 certified"?
No. AAMedP-1.9 names no certification, accreditation or notified-body scheme for an organisation. What it describes is an individual clinician's examination and treatment of an aircrew member, which is professional medical practice, not a certificate a company or unit holds.
What is the difference between AAMedP-1.9 and STANAG 7165?
STANAG 7165 is the NATO agreement recording nations' commitment to use AAMedP-1.9; it is the cover that gives the publication its force. AAMedP-1.9 is the publication itself, the document that sets out the initial investigation and immediate management of a suspected laser eye injury in aircrew.
